                This week I have chosen to muse about Reading Slumps:

    Recently I have found myself in a reading slump, I haven't really been very motivated to read and have been spending more time watching TV and playing computer games. I never believed people when they said they were in a reading slump, I always thought they were just being lazy, but now I realise it is a thing. I am not being lazy as I have taken my dog on long walks, and blitzed the house, I just don't feel like reading. And even when I do pick my book up after a couple of pages I want to put it down, but its not the story, I am enjoying it, I just don't want to read it at the moment. But rest assured I will keep on trying and hopefully, get of this slump eventually.

    This weeks question is ....

     
    Do you prefer Nook, Kindle, other reader or paper book?


    My answer is ....


    I prefer paper book, there is nothing better than being able to flick through the pages Although I do like the convenience of having a kindle, you can take lots of books anywhere with you without taking up a load of space. And also if there is a must have book that is just released you can purchased it on kindle immediately and not have to trawl around bookshops trying to find it.
